Genetic inhibition of autophagy prevents adipogenic differentiation. A: Oil Red O staining of 3T3-L1 adipocytes infected with nontarget shRNA or 1 of the 3 Atg5 shRNA lentiviruses. B: quantification of Oil Red O staining [n = 9/treatment; ***P < 0.01 vs. nontarget shRNA (RNAi-N)]. C: Western blot analysis of markers for adipogenic differentiation and transcription factors involved in adipogenic differentiation. D: Oil Red O staining of wild-type (WT), Atg5−/+, and Atg5−/− mouse embryonic fibroblasts (MEF). E: quantification of Oil Red O staining (n = 7–9/genotype; ***P < 0.001 vs. WT). F: Western blot analysis of markers for autophagy, adipogenic differentiation, and transcription factors involved in adipogenic differentiation. Please note that the band indicated by an arrow is Atg5, which is missing in Atg5−/− MEF. All images shown are representative of 3 independent experiments with triplicate samples. FABP4, fatty acid-binding protein 4.
